# Spoolhaven printer-spooler service: tuning constants.
#
# Support team: these values govern how the spooler queues,
# retries, and expires print jobs. A job that exceeds the retry
# ceiling moves to the dead-letter tray and the customer sees
# error code PRNT-HOLD. Raising the retry ceiling delays that
# error but can back up the whole queue on a stuck device, so
# please escalate to engineering before suggesting changes to
# any customer. The current production values are defined here.

tuning table, yajog-yahof:
BUDGETS = {
    "lamvan": 303,
    "wenox": 460,
    "fenvan": 525,
}

# Project Larkspur — Status (Managers Only)

Project Larkspur, the internal tooling migration led by Dorian Ashe, is now eight weeks behind schedule. Root causes include vendor delays at Copewell Systems and underestimated data-cleanup effort. Department heads should plan around a revised March completion and avoid committing dependent milestones. Given the sensitivity of timing, the related planning note is appended below.

internal memo for yahag-hahig: Belwynix Group plans to lower the Silir list price by 62 percent in May.

### Changed defaults — Fernpipe hot reload

As of release 4.2, Fernpipe watches its configuration tree and applies changes without a restart by default; previously this required an explicit flag. Plugin authors should note that reload events now fire for nested keys, so handlers registered on a parent path will be invoked more often. Debounce your handlers accordingly. Fresh installs of the Fernpipe agent now ship with the following configuration values.

service settings:
[casax]
port = 6379
team = rusir
host = casax.zemvarhq.corp
region = outer-4
access_code = ac_9808ce
timeout_ms = 1500